The role

The International Rescue Committee is seeking a Career Development Specialist to help refugees and immigrants overcome employment barriers and secure sustainable career paths. The role involves providing one-on-one case management, resume coaching, and job placement assistance while collaborating with local employers. This position requires a blend of administrative support, community outreach, and direct client mentorship to foster economic self-sufficiency. The specialist will work in a hybrid environment, necessitating flexibility to support clients across various settings.

What you'll do

  • Provide one-on-one resume assistance, interview prep, and job search coaching.
  • Develop and maintain individualized career development plans for clients.
  • Conduct outreach to employers to identify job and apprenticeship opportunities.
  • Monitor client progress and ensure accurate compliance with reporting requirements.
  • Advocate for clients' rights and educate employers on the benefits of hiring diverse populations.

What it takes

  • Undergraduate degree or equivalent work experience.
  • At least one year of experience in social services or workforce programming.
  • Excellent interpersonal communication skills with the ability to work with diverse populations.
  • Fluency in MS Office and database management experience.
  • Multilingual skills in languages such as Spanish, French, Arabic, Dari, Farsi, or Pashto preferred.
